Driven Out is a challenging 2d side-scroller with deliberate combat and beautiful 16 bit retro aesthetic. Our Heroine is forced from her home into a dangerous world in upheaval. Forced to fight dangerous fantastical creatures.
Luckily our heroine has stumbled upon a magical contraption that creates copies of herself if she perishes. As long as this strange device has power she can place custom checkpoints. However, be warned, it is a fragile device and if the enemies choose to attack the device it will quickly break.
These enemies are numerous and varied in this seamless world. Our heroine has no combat experience but as long as she keeps her wits about her and read the enemies moves she can prevail. The enemies are also not without wit and might choose to attack the checkpoint if left unprotected.
